Department Information
The IU School of Social Work works in collaboration with the Indiana Department of Child Services (DSC) to better protect children at risk of abuse and neglect. A key to this collaboration is the creation of the Child Welfare Education and Training Partnership. The Partnership is designed to provide high quality social work education and statewide training for public child welfare employees. It provides Bachelor’s of Social Work (BSW) students with preparation for employment, it allows DCS employees to enroll in the School’s part-time Master’s of Social Work (MSW) Program, and it provides state-of-the-art training to current DCS employees
